Transaction 23e70f8c5aa216552e96593251c6c94ea5868d85b6c57a199bab01b2b66d832e
1 Input
1 Output
-
23e70f8c5aa216552e96593251c6c94ea5868d85b6c57a199bab01b2b66d832e:0
- value
- 3127231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a63297f21e032baa6433bfd906e1e9a22931071a OP_EQUAL
- address
- 3GqnhgsZwxFaSL21AWTZ65xsv3o3KKKgTX